Cultural context
Hunter is an English occupational surname meaning 'one who hunts,' parallel to names like Mason, Cooper, and Carter. It crossed into first-name usage in the US in the 1980s and reached the top fifty by the late 1990s. Hunter S. Thompson gave the name countercultural literary prestige alongside its sporting associations. The name surged in rural and Southern US regions where hunting heritage is a point of family pride. It projects rugged independence, outdoor capability, and a self-reliant character.

How the morse encodes
'HUNTER' begins with H (dit-dit-dit-dit), four dots in a row — the longest all-dot letter in standard morse. This gives the name a rapid stuttering opening before settling into more varied patterns. Total: H + U + N + T + E + R = 4 + 2 + 2 + 1 + 1 + 3 = 13 elements.
